Projection Mapping – HeavyM is a creative digital media course designed to introduce learners to the exciting world of projection mapping using the HeavyM software. This course explains how static objects and architectural surfaces can be transformed into immersive visual displays through light, motion, and digital content. Learners will explore the core principles of projection mapping, from understanding surfaces and shapes to synchronising visuals with sound and movement.
The course focuses on using HeavyM as a projection mapping tool, guiding learners through interface navigation, visual effects, layers, masking, and content control. It also covers creative workflows for designing projection mapping projects for events, exhibitions, installations, performances, and artistic showcases. Emphasis is placed on visual storytelling, timing, and adapting designs for different environments and audiences.

Course programme
Projection Mapping – HeavyM introduces the creative and technical fundamentals of projection mapping using HeavyM software. The course covers setting up projections, mapping visuals to surfaces, creating dynamic animations, synchronising content with music, and managing live performances, enabling learners to design engaging visual experiences for events, installations, and performances.
Course Curriculum
- Projection Mapping - HeavyM
- Module 01: Introduction
- Module 02: Downloading HeavyM
- Module 03: Installing HeavyM
- Module 04: Example Project
- Module 05: Opening and Interface
- Module 06: Interface and shapes
- Module 07: Creating Media
- Module 08: Border effect
- Module 09: Repeat effect
- Module 10: Colour Special
- Module 11: Snake effect
- Module 12: Rotation & Structure
- Module 13: Importing Media
- Module 14: Scenes
- Module 15: Creating your own shapes
- Module 16: What is syphon?
- Module 17: Syphon VDMX5
- Module 18: Synesthesia
- Module 19: Activate Synesthesia
- Module 20: Syphon Synesthesia into HeavyM
- Module 21: Mapping with the Olga Kit
- Module 22: Made in HeavyM
- Module 23: Review Video
